Frequently Asked Questions about Fort Lauderdale
How much are Studio apartments in Fort Lauderdale?
There are currently 2,402 Studio Apartments in Fort Lauderdale with rent ranges from $999 to $4,950 with an average price of $2,186.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Fort Lauderdale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Fort Lauderdale ranges from $925 to $11,089 with an average monthly rent of $2,596.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Fort Lauderdale c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Fort Lauderdale range from $1,225 to $10,932.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,325.
How expensive are Fort Lauderdale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 434 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Fort Lauderdale on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,617 to $18,797 - averaging $4,458 for the location.
